Why the Arabic Version is Essential
When searching for a Fathul Mueen PDF Arabic, many students wonder if a translated version is sufficient. While translations into English, Indonesian, and Urdu exist, the Arabic original remains indispensable for three reasons: Shamela (shamela
- Precision: Fiqh terminology (e.g., najis, hadd, rukhsah) loses nuance in translation.
- Memorization: Students of traditional Islam memorize key passages in Arabic.
- Further Study: Advanced commentaries (like I’anat al-Talibin) assume you have mastered the Arabic of Fathul Mueen.
